What is an Article? An article is a little word that comes before a noun ) There are 3 common articles in English: The An A 3

What is an Article? Many English language learners have difficulty choosing which article to use, or deciding if an article is needed. The first step is to look at the noun: Is it Specific – do you know which one OR can you see it? Is it a Proper Noun OR Is it Countable ? Is it Singular or Plural ? Have a look at the following chart: 4

5 Articles at a glance:

Article: A or An Use a or an before a noun that: is general (non specific) can be counted . Examples: I want to watch a movie . (any movie) I want a new job. (any job) 6

Use A: 1. Use a before a consonant sound: They bought a car . Vancouver is a beautiful city. There is a hair on my plate. 2. Use “ a ” when “u” sounds like /y/: Mina is in a union . 7

Use An: 1. Use an before a vowel sound. I watched an owl fly overhead. I ate an orange for breakfast. That is an ugly car. Use an when the “h” is silent Jake is an honest man. * NOTE : It is the sound and not the letter that determines whether you use a or an. 8

Use The: Use the before a specific noun . Specific means: you can see the noun you know which noun it is. Examples: The black-and-white puppy is really cute. (you know which puppy it is.) I am buying the blue dress . (you know which dress it is.) 9

The Use the before nouns that are: specific specific and plural non-countable Examples: The new rug matches the sofa . (specific) (specific) 2. The students made the posters in this room. (specific, plural) 3. The children played in the sand all day. (specific, plural) (non-countable) 10

No article No article is needed before: 1. a general, plural noun (dogs/cars/books). Example: Our family likes dogs. 2. a general, non-countable noun Example: He drinks coffee every day. Can you make rice for dinner? 3. a general, abstract noun Example: Love is celebrated on Valentine’s day. 11

No article No article is needed before: 4. Names of People, Companies, most Places, Universities (that don’t use “of”) Justin Trudeau, Microsoft, Facebook, Costco New York, Toronto, Winnipeg Cambridge, Oxford Exceptions: The United States, The United Kingdom 12

No article No article is needed before: 5. Days of the week, Months of the year, Addresses On Thursday, we’ll have dinner together. January is typically a cold month. I live at 22 Wickson Place, Toronto, Ontario. 13

Articles: General Tips Use the when there is only one of the noun. the sun, the moon (in the sky) the mall, the library, the hospital (in a city) 2. Use the for the second mention of a noun. I bought a laptop yesterday. The laptop was expensive I want a new puppy. The puppy must be house broken. 14

Articles: General Tips 3. Use the with the names of oceans, seas, mountain ranges, deserts, and rivers • The Amazon is longer than the Mississippi. 15

Articles: General Tips 4. Use the with a general noun when the noun is followed by that and information that describes it (an adjective clause). • The shoes that I wear every day are red. • The TV that I want to buy is really big. 5. Use a, an or no article with a specific noun when the sentence starts with “There is/are” and includes a preposition. Use the after the preposition. • There is a dog on the sofa. • There are flowers in the vases. 16
